Non-destructive testing or non-destructive testing (NDT) is a broad group of analysis techniques used in the science and technology industry to evaluate the properties of a material, component or system without causing damage. The terms non-destructive examination (NDE), non-destructive inspection (NDI) and non-destructive evaluation (NDE) are also commonly used to describe this technology. Because NDT does not permanently alter the item being inspected, it is a very valuable technique that can save both money and time in product evaluation, problem solving and research. The six most commonly used methods of NDT are Foucault current, magnetic particles, penetrating liquids, radiographic, ultrasonic and visual tests. NDT is commonly used in forensic engineering, mechanical engineering, petroleum engineering, electrical engineering, civil engineering, systems engineering, aeronautical engineering, medicine and art. Innovations in the field of non-destructive testing have had a profound impact on medical images, including echocardiography, medical ultrasound and digital radiography.
